Abstract
On the basis of the overall signal line shape in the1H NMR spectra of [6,6]-closed and [5,6]-open fullerene-C60 cycloadducts with 1-(4-nitrophenyl)-3-phenylnitrile ylide we determined the values of the long range spin-spin coupling for the aliphatic proton of the heterocyclic fragment with the aromatic protons.
